FMX.Layers3D.TAbstractLayer3D.LayerMouseDown

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

procedure LayerMouseDown(Button: TMouseButton; Shift: TShiftState; X, Y: Single); virtual;

C++

virtual void __fastcall LayerMouseDown(System::Uitypes::TMouseButton Button, System::Classes::TShiftState Shift, float X, float Y);

Propriétés

Type Visibilité  Source Unité  Parent
procedure
function
protected
FMX.Layers3D.pas
FMX.Layers3D.hpp
FMX.Layers3D TAbstractLayer3D

Description

Est un répartiteur d'événements OnLayerMouseDown.

Redéfinissez la méthode protégée LayerMouseDown pour fournir des réponses en plus de l'appel du gestionnaire d'événements OnLayerMouseDown lorsque l'utilisateur enfonce un bouton de la souris alors que la zone réactive du curseur se trouve au-dessus de la couche 3D.

Un contrôle 3D appelle LayerMouseDown en réponse à tout événement d'enfoncement de la souris, et décode les paramètres du message dans l'état et la position de la touche Maj, qu'il transmet respectivement aux paramètres Shift, X et Y. La valeur du paramètre Button indique quel bouton de la souris a été enfoncé : gauche, droit ou du milieu.

Voir aussi